About Veterans Benefits Law in Portugal
Veterans Benefits in Portugal are designed to support individuals who have served in the military, recognizing their service and providing assistance for a smooth transition to civilian life. These benefits can include financial support, healthcare, education assistance, and employment help. The benefits are governed by laws that ensure veterans' needs are met in various aspects of life, maintaining their dignity and well-being.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the basic eligibility requirements for Veterans Benefits in Portugal?
The basic eligibility requirements usually include having served in the military, being discharged under certain conditions, and in some cases, having a service-connected disability. Specific criteria may vary depending on the benefits sought.
How can I apply for Veterans Benefits in Portugal?
Applications can typically be submitted through local government offices dedicated to veterans' affairs. It's crucial to gather all necessary documentation related to your military service and any specific conditions connected to the benefits you are applying for.
What documents are necessary for a Veterans Benefits application?
Commonly required documents include proof of military service, discharge papers, identification, and any medical records if applying for health-related benefits.
Can family members of veterans receive benefits?
Yes, in certain circumstances, family members like spouses and dependents may be eligible for benefits, particularly in cases involving healthcare or educational assistance.
What should I do if my benefits application is denied?
If your application is denied, you can appeal the decision. It's advisable to consult with a lawyer who can help navigate the appeals process and ensure that all necessary information is presented clearly.
Are there any educational benefits available for veterans?
Yes, veterans may be eligible for educational benefits which can aid in pursuing further education or vocational training as part of reintegration into civilian life.
What health benefits are available to veterans?
Veterans can access healthcare benefits that may include medical services, specialist care, and mental health support, depending on the terms of their entitlement.
How do military pensions work in Portugal?
Military pensions are typically based on rank, years of service, and other factors. It is important to check the specific regulations governing military pensions to understand your entitlement.
Is legal assistance covered under Veterans Benefits?
Legal assistance may be provided or subsidized in certain cases, especially if it pertains to the benefits claims process or other related disputes.
What organizations can help me understand my rights better?
There are several organizations in Portugal that offer guidance on veterans' rights, including veterans' associations, governmental offices, and non-profit groups dedicated to supporting military personnel and their families.
